What is a FHA home improvement loan?
An FHA 203(k) rehab loan, also referred to as a renovation loan, enables homebuyers and homeowners to finance both the purchase or refinance along with the renovation of a home through a single mortgage.

What are the negatives of a home equity loan?
Disadvantages of a Home Equity LoanRisk:Your home is the collateral.
Going Underwater:If you tap into your home's equity, and later its value declines, you could owe more on your home than it's actually worth.
Closing Costs and Fees:Home equity loans can serve as a second mortgage.
